    Critical VingCard Hotel Lock Vulnerability

    A critical vulnerability exists in the ASSA ABLOY Hospitality Vision by VingCard hotel lock system, versions 6.4.2 and older using radio-frequency identification (RFID). The vulnerability can be exploited by an attacker to clone guest keys or create master keys. Hotels using this system are asked to take immediate remediation steps to avoid impact.
